Waiting shed inaugurated at Nerhe Phezha

Correspondent

A newly constructed waiting shed was inaugurated by PS to chief minister, Neiketouzo Kengurüse at College of Arts & Technology (CAT), Nerhe Phezha, here, on Tuesday.
The shed was constructed by Vitho Society based at Nerhema as part of its goodwill gesture towards CAT.
Speaking at the occasion, Kengurüse expressed happiness over the establishment of CAT at Nerhe Phezha, which, he said, was the first college within 11th Northern Angami-II assembly constituency. He sought for the support of the public towards the college for holistic development of students. Vitho Society has been undertaking various charitable activities since its formation in 1988, he said.
In a short speech, Educational Visionary Forum, chairman Rev. Dr. Tseibu Rutsa, expressed gratitude to Vitho Society for showing their concern and support to CAT. The programme was chaired by society’s president Neiketou Kiewhuo.
